Factors Affecting Used Laptop Prices in 2024

A variety of factors will affect the price of laptops for sale that are used in Pakistan by 2024. Knowing these aspects is essential to make an informed buying choice.

  • Brand and Model: The reputation of the brand and its popularity are key factors of used laptop price in Pakistan. Laptops made by well-known brands such as Dell, HP, Lenovo and Apple are usually sold at more expensive prices on the second-hand market because of their reputation for quality and durability. In addition, certain models might be in greater demand which can result in higher costs.
  • Age and Condition: The condition and age of a laptop used are key factors that influence the price. The latest laptops, which are typically less than two years old from their release date, generally are more expensive when compared with older versions. The state of the laptop such as scratches, dents and any visible damages can affect the value of the laptop.
  • Specifications and Performance: The specs and performance of a used laptop are crucial in determining the price. Laptops that have higher-end processors, greater memory, more capacity storage with dedicated graphics cards can command more money than those that have basic or obsolete specifications.
  • Demand and Supply: Supply and demand profoundly affects the price of laptops that are second-hand in Pakistan. Demand for certain models or brands may drive price increases, whereas an excess of laptops could result in lower prices. External factors, like current economic conditions and consumer trends can influence supply and demand changes.

Tips for Buying a Second-Hand Laptop in Pakistan

To assure an efficient and best purchase, take note of these tips before purchasing an used laptop in Pakistan:

  1. Get all the information: You can know about the laptop model that you’re looking at, its specifications and prices on the second-hand market.
  2. Verify the condition: Examine the laptop for any physical damages, and warrant that all the components including your keyboard and touchpad and display, function in a proper manner.
  3. Verify the authenticity of the laptop: Ask for the proof of purchase in order to warrant you are sure that your computer was not stolen or acquired through fraudulent methods.
  4. Test the performance: Perform the benchmarks as well as stress tests in order to test the laptop’s performance and pinpoint any potential problems.
  5. Make an offer: Do not hesitate to bargain the price, particularly if you spot any defects or the buyer seems keen to sell.
  6. Think about warranties and support after sales: Ask about any warranties or support options after sales from the vendor or third-party service providers.
